That said, I just did a little experimenting and here's a tip: As long as you're not standing on the platform you planted the bomb on, you will not die in the explosion, no matter how close you are. This is useful on some of the later boards where there's a wall on a narrow ledge. You can plant the bomb, step off the platform and simply hover right next to it and no harm will come to your H.E.R.O. when the bomb takes out the wall. Another tip: If you need to get airborne, it's quicker to step off a ledge then to push up from a standing position -- your prop-pack will automatically kick on when there's nothing but air beneath your feet. Just remember to push up as soon as you step off the ledge -- gravity is stronger than your prop-pack! Tip: To get past the fast moving snake in the narrow shaft on level 10, drop straight down the shaft without hesitating, turn to the left and fire as you go past. If you do hesitate (ie. use the prop pack) go back up to the previous screen and drop again and your timing will always be perfect!
